I like it. I just installed it yesterday and had a chance to test it while riding my KLR-650. He kept my phone charged. The ON/OFF button is required. The button allows you to turn off the charger when the bike is not in use to prevent battery drain. My bike has a single cylinder engine. There is some vibration. The rubber pads on the handlebar clamp are made of soft rubber and effectively reduce the vibration of the charger. To be on the safe side, I had to install an additional 5A fuse next to the battery pole. This is very important as it will prevent a fire due to a short circuit in the wire. All electrical devices in the car should be connected as close as possible to the battery terminals. So far I am satisfied with the charger and I recommend it to everyone.
